Transaction 5e8fbaba57e1e90c06dada264bbb1fa5f65eb02816e2fd26e055930c777e7731
1 Input
1 Output
-
5e8fbaba57e1e90c06dada264bbb1fa5f65eb02816e2fd26e055930c777e7731:0
- value
- 63061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27974b664d61a40a68d957b8c66fc076b43042e1 OP_EQUAL
- address
- 35JMX9r9c3hSP79zA4pN9kXPqkBjVXK4xw